Q: Is 25,512,769 a Prime Number?
A: No, 25,512,769 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 25512769 can be evenly divided by 1 53 481,373 and 25,512,769, with no remainder.
Since 25,512,769 cannot be divided by just 1 and 25,512,769, it is not a prime number.
